The Foundation of UK Adult Industry Regulation

 

The UK maintains a comprehensive regulatory framework for adult entertainment and products, governed by various authorities including trading standards, local licensing authorities, and age verification regulators. This multi-layered approach ensures appropriate oversight while recognizing the industry’s legitimate place in the market.

 

Key Areas of Regulation

 

Age Verification and Access Control


One of the most critical aspects of regulation is ensuring that adult content and products remain accessible only to those legally permitted to view and purchase them. The UK has implemented some of the world’s most stringent age verification requirements, including:
– Robust digital age verification systems
– Multiple forms of identification checks
– Regular auditing of verification processes
– Strict penalties for non-compliance
